📉 STEEM Is Still Far Below Its Historical High

STEEM has experienced several major cycles since its launch.

Its historical all-time high was above $8, reached in January 2018. Today, STEEM trades at only a small fraction of that level.

This huge difference is one reason some crypto traders continue watching STEEM during periods of strong market growth.

But being far below an old all-time high does not automatically mean that STEEM will return there. Market capitalization, liquidity, adoption and the overall crypto market all matter.

📊 Could STEEM Reach $0.10, $0.50 or $1?

These levels should be viewed as scenarios rather than predictions.

For example, if STEEM were around $0.05:

$0.10 would represent approximately a 2× move.
$0.50 would represent approximately a 10× move.
$1 would represent approximately a 20× move.

The important point is that the required market capitalization would also increase substantially.

Therefore, investors should not look only at the number of dollars per coin. Market capitalization and circulating supply are much more important when evaluating potential price targets.

⚠️ The Risks Should Not Be Ignored

There are also important reasons to remain cautious.

STEEM faces competition from other blockchain ecosystems, including Hive, which originated from the Steem community split in 2020.

Liquidity can also change quickly. Recent STEEM price analysis has shown periods where trading volume increased dramatically, highlighting how volatile the market can be.

Therefore, buying STEEM simply because its price is much lower than its historical ATH would be an incomplete strategy.
